Elsinore, Wed & Thurs

Big days! Real strong lift. The thermals had sharp edges. Wed. I launched at 12:30 and Thurs. I took off at 12:20. Wed the corner house themal worked good for me. I had an hour and 15 min of some serious rock and roll flying. I got up to 8613' msl. Thurs. I got to the house thermal and then sank out. I crossed over to the right side of the E bowl and worked that spine down, (figuring I was headed for the lz), until I caught one coming up the spine. I rode that to 5K msl, over the ranches. Today, it wasn't so rough. Still pretty strong. I got up to a little over 9K. Got pretty chilly up there after a while. I came down and landed after 2 hours and 30 minutes. Wind in the LZ was down,(west), at 12-17 mph. Made for an easy landing.
